我在使用ScrollView时遇到问题。出于某种奇怪的原因,它隐藏了要在顶部显示的内容。我尝试提供边距、填充等,但似乎没有任何效果。这是我的布局:我的图像隐藏在顶部标题栏后面,并且在设备/模拟器中只能看到其底部的一小部分。它在Eclipse中看起来很好。我正在使用ADT11提前致谢! 最佳答案 您好,我遇到了同样的问题,经过调查我找到了解决方案,在您的XML代码中我可以看到您在布局中犯了同样的错误。问题是您将ScrollView子项(LinearLayout)layout_gravity设置为居中。删除这一行,它应该适合你。andr
你好,我正在为一个网站开发应用程序。我遇到折叠工具栏和嵌套ScrollView的问题。第一次打开文章时,它看起来像这样(http://imgur.com/UpIJa59)。向下滚动后,文本和图像之间的空白将被移除。这是我对这个Activity的布局:你有什么建议?谢谢。 最佳答案 我通过向NestedScrollView添加android:layout_gravity="fill_vertical"解决了这个问题。同样的问题在这里CollapsingToolbarLayoutsometimesleaveswhitespacebelo
我在recyclerview行中使用了mapView。我附上了截图。滚动map时显示黑色闪烁背景。适配器代码:@OverridepublicRecyclerView.ViewHolderonCreateViewHolder(ViewGroupparent,intviewType){if(viewType==TASK_VIEW){returnnewTasksViewHolder(LayoutInflater.from(parent.getContext()).inflate(R.layout.item_task_row,parent,false));}elseif(viewType==C
我在ScrollView中有一个RelativeLayout,我已将其设置为fill_parent。但是,它只能水平填充,不能垂直填充。我想在RelativeLayout中放置更多内容,但首先我需要弄清楚为什么RelativeLayout不会填满ScrollView的高度。感谢您的帮助。 最佳答案 添加android:fillViewPort="true"到ScrollView。fill_parent或match_parentScrollView中的高度没有实际意义,它会被忽略-否则就不需要滚动.fillViewPort="true
我在ScrollView内的LinearLayout中有2个RecyclerViews:مارکتپیکیعلی"android:textAppearance="@style/Base.TextAppearance.AppCompat.Subhead"android:textColor="@color/light_black2"/>两个回收商都有nestedScrollEnabledflase。问题出在这里:当布局呈现时,第一个recyclerView将填充,屏幕底部的第二个recyclerView将不会显示所有项目,因为第一个高度!但它应该滚动,因为它们都在scrollView中!所
我的android应用程序中有以下XML布局,使用ScrollView:dScrollView上方的View卡住良好并且View滚动得足够好。问题是包含Buttons的LinearLayout被抛出了View。看不见。非常感谢任何帮助。谢谢。 最佳答案 在ScrollView上,尝试将android:layout_height更改为"fill_parent"添加android:layout_weight="1"。这应该使ScrollView将其高度设置为您的按钮组与其上方的其他View之间的间隙。此外,尽量不要将ScrollView
安卓4.1.0。我有一个水平ScrollView,在其中-LinearLayout。在LinearLayout中,我在fragmentonResume中以编程方式添加了一些子项。在child适合View的情况下,一切都很好。如果child不适合View,HorizontalView会隐藏左侧的前n个元素,并为右侧的n个元素保留可用空间。我尝试调用computeScroll或requestLayout/forceLayout,但没有帮助。...和fragment中的代码:publicvoidonResume(){super.onResume();productsPanel.remov
我是Android新手-我在屏幕上放置了一个ScrollView,只是在其中放置了一些文本。我这样做是因为在某些手机上,文本会从屏幕上消失。我遇到的问题是我放到页面上的ScrollView比它包含的内容长——手机屏幕越窄,ScrollView越长。在这个之后还有一些编辑文本,但这是它的要点。如果您看到一些愚蠢的事情,请告诉我。 最佳答案 您的背景位于ScrollView中的线性布局中。如果将ScrollView放在另一个线性布局中,该布局是ScrollView的父级并包含背景,并从作为ScrollView子级的线性布局中删除背景,问
我在ScrollView中的LinearLayout中有一个GridView,它从服务器分页数据。在GridView下方是一个用于加载更多数据的按钮。我的GridView的最终高度将大于屏幕。如果我将GridView的高度设置为wrap_content或parent_fill,它会将自身调整为精确可用的屏幕高度并且根本不滚动,裁剪掉额外的行。如果我将layout_height显式设置为较大的值(例如1000dip),则滚动会正常运行,但我无法先验预测ScrollView的最终高度。如何以编程方式确定GridView的必要高度以获得所需的行为?下面是我的布局。如您所见,我将高度设置为10
我的android页面有10个EditText和10个TextView。但是在图形布局中我的屏幕上没有空间。我只加了5个。我正在使用滚动布局。如何在不降低项目高度的情况下在屏幕中添加额外的5个项目。这里有编码吗? 最佳答案 ........您可以在LinearLayout中添加多个项目。由于ScrollView是可滚动的,因此不会影响内部View的尺寸。您可以根据需要添加任意数量的View,而不必担心屏幕大小或View大小。 关于android-如何在Android的Scrollview